Move from content creation to campaign execution without the handoffs

The biggest breakdown in marketing is not creating content. It is getting that content into the right systems, approved, and aligned with the latest information. This month, Jasper connects both sides of that problem. Content now moves directly into more execution systems, while staying continuously synced with your source of truth. That means fewer handoffs, fewer outdated outputs, and far less time spent fixing content after it is generated.

  • Send finished content directly into Adobe Workfront. Export assets from Jasper into the exact project and folder where approvals happen. Content moves straight into your execution workflow without manual steps, reducing delays between drafting and review.
  • Keep your system of record intact while speeding it up. Adobe Workfront remains your hub for governance, approvals, and tracking. Jasper simply feeds it high-quality content without forcing your team to change how they operate.
  • Sync your IQ directly from Google Drive. Connect folders to Jasper so your latest messaging, positioning, and strategy are always reflected in outputs. Changes to documents automatically flow into Jasper without manual updates
  • Move content seamlessly into Google Drive. Export content directly into shared folders so teams can immediately collaborate, distribute, and activate assets without moving files between tools.

Scale execution with repeatable workflows instead of one-off work

Most teams already know what works. The problem is they can't scale it. Workflows live in scattered prompts, one off setups, or individual knowledge. So every new campaign starts from scratch. This month, enhancements to Jasper Grid make execution repeatable. It turns your best workflows into systems you can reuse, adapt, and scale across teams, regions, and campaigns.

  • Turn your best workflows into reusable Grid templates: Save complete Grid setups including structure, prompts, inputs, and sample data. Teams can start from a proven system instead of rebuilding every time, which speeds up campaign launch and improves consistency from the start.
  • Standardize how work gets done across teams and regions: Share templates across your workspace so different teams are not interpreting strategy differently. Everyone works from the same foundation, which keeps output aligned even as more people contribute.
  • Build more flexible workflows with drag and drop and structured inputs: Move columns easily, organize your workflow visually, and structure inputs in a way that matches how your team actually works. This makes workflows easier to build, adapt, and maintain over time.
  • Bring brand intelligence directly into execution with IQ inputs: Add Brand Voice, Audiences, and Style Guides as input columns in Grid and reference them directly in prompts and agents. This ensures every output is grounded in your brand without requiring manual checks.
  • Enrich outputs with real time context from web and knowledge search: Use web search and knowledge search inside Grid agents to pull in the latest information and context, making outputs more relevant and complete.
  • Scale without rebuilding using duplication across IQ assets: Duplicate Brand Voices, Audiences, and Style Guides instantly so you can expand workflows across regions, products, or use cases without recreating complex setups.

Everything else: Making execution more reliable as you scale

As your workflows scale across more teams and assets, the details matter. Managing content, maintaining consistency, and understanding what is happening across the workspace becomes just as important as generating content. This month’s improvements focus on making Jasper easier to operate day to day so teams can scale without adding friction or risk.

  • Improve consistency across Brand Voice, Audiences, and Style Guides: System wide IQ improvements make outputs more accurate and reliable, reducing off brand content and minimizing editing time before assets are ready to use.
  • Adapt Jasper to how you work with Personal Instructions: Set persistent user level guidance so Jasper reflects your preferred tone, format, and assumptions without repeating instructions in every prompt.
  • Work within complex file systems without friction: Navigate nested folders in integrations like Google Drive and SharePoint so content lands exactly where it belongs.
  • Make integrations easier to understand and adopt: A clearer integrations experience shows what is available, what is enabled, and what requires admin access, reducing confusion and speeding up onboarding.
  • Improve output quality with more reliable research and style controls: Research Agents produce more accurate outputs with working sources and deeper analysis, while Style Guide improvements make rules easier to understand and apply.
  • Get clearer visibility into usage and impact: Updated reporting provides more accurate metrics, better exports, and clearer insight into how Jasper is being used across your organization.
  • Keep your source of truth organized as your team grows: Visibility controls across Brand Voice, Audiences, Style Guides, and Knowledge make it easier to manage what is official, personal, and shared.
